Here is what Galileo said:

¡¡

What greater stupidity can be imagined than that of calling jewels, silver, and gold ¡°precious¡± and soil ¡°base?¡± People who do this ought to remember that if there were as great a scarcity of soil as of jewels and precious metals, there would not be a prince who would not spend a bushel of diamonds and rubies and a cartload of gold just to have enough earth to plant a jasmine in a little pot, or to sow an orange seed and watch it sprout, grow, and produce its handsome leaves, its fragrant flowers, and fine fruit. It is scarcity and plenty that make the vulgar take things to be precious of worthless.

¡¡

Galileo Galilei, dialogue

from Galileo¡¯s daughter by dava Sobel, Penguin books, @2000
